I've been prescribed a medication of Thyrox 75, Thyropace, Orofer, Beplex Forte. I see a weight gain of 4 kgs (92 to 96) in two weeks of this medication. Would you suggest I alter/stop any of them?
This medication was prescribed after my TSH was detected to be 0.07 while I was on Thyrox 100 medication earlier due to hypothyroidism. And my iron level was detected to be 39 mcg/dl.

Due tp TSH 0.07.. what ever .. weight loss happened may be gained after chamgingbthe dose tob75 mcg... but may not be 4 kgs...
may be 1 to 2 kgs gain may be due to that
Other 2 kgs may be life style change
Other medicines may not cause weight gain
